소스 검색

core: srapi - cseq update field update to be a function

Daniel-Constantin Mierla 9 년 전
부모
커밋
2880cd6278
1개의 변경된 파일3개의 추가작업 그리고 1개의 파일을 삭제
  1. 3 1
      srapi.h

+ 3 - 1
srapi.h

@@ -20,6 +20,7 @@
 #define __SRAPI_H__
 
 #include "str.h"
+#include "parser/msg_parser.h"
 
 typedef void (*sr_generate_callid_f)(str*);
 
@@ -27,8 +28,9 @@ int sr_register_callid_func(sr_generate_callid_f f);
 
 sr_generate_callid_f sr_get_callid_func(void);
 
+typedef int (*sr_cseq_update_f)(sip_msg_t*);
 typedef struct sr_cfgenv {
-	int cseq_update;
+	sr_cseq_update_f cb_cseq_update;
 } sr_cfgenv_t;
 
 void sr_cfgenv_init(void);